Supercritical Fluid Chromatography Market Segmentation and Market Companies
Segments
- Based on type, the global supercritical fluid chromatography market can be segmented into stationary phase, mobile phase, and accessories. The stationary phase segment is expected to hold a significant share in the market due to the increasing demand for different types of stationary phases to separate a wide range of compounds. The mobile phase segment is also expected to witness substantial growth attributed to the rising adoption of supercritical fluid chromatography for its efficiency in separating complex mixtures. The accessories segment is projected to show steady growth as they are essential components for conducting supercritical fluid chromatography experiments.
- In terms of application, the market can be divided into pharmaceutical analysis, food and beverage analysis, environmental analysis, and others. The pharmaceutical analysis segment is anticipated to dominate the market owing to the growing need for analyzing pharmaceutical compounds with high efficiency and accuracy. The food and beverage analysis segment is likely to witness significant growth due to the stringent regulations regarding food safety and quality. The environmental analysis segment is also poised for considerable expansion as environmental concerns continue to drive the demand for monitoring and analyzing pollutants.
- On the basis of end-user, the market can be categorized into pharmaceutical & biotechnology companies, academic research institutes, contract research organizations, and others. The pharmaceutical & biotechnology companies segment is expected to lead the market as these companies heavily rely on supercritical fluid chromatography techniques for drug discovery and development processes. Academic research institutes are projected to exhibit substantial growth as they increasingly adopt advanced chromatography technologies for various research purposes.
